Ordinals
beta
Sat 1513852020610433
decimal
395540.2020610433
degree
0°185540′404″2020610433‴
percentile
72.0881915369367%
name
dcxvhegfzrs
cycle
0
epoch
1
period
196
block
395540
offset
2020610433
timestamp
2016-01-29 02:22:32 UTC
rarity
common
prev
next